Software Evolution
Software has become omnipresent and vital in our information-based society, so all software producers should assume responsibility for its reliability. While "reliable" originally assumed implementations that were effective and mainly error-free, additional issues like adaptability and mai...
Κύριοι συγγραφείς: | , |
---|---|
Συγγραφή απο Οργανισμό/Αρχή: | |
Μορφή: | Ηλεκτρονική πηγή Ηλ. βιβλίο |
Γλώσσα: | English |
Έκδοση: |
Berlin, Heidelberg :
Springer Berlin Heidelberg : Imprint: Springer,
2008.
|
Θέματα: | |
Διαθέσιμο Online: | Full Text via HEAL-Link |
Πίνακας περιεχομένων:
- and Roadmap: History and Challenges of Software Evolution
- and Roadmap: History and Challenges of Software Evolution
- Understanding and Analysing Software Evolution
- Identifying and Removing Software Clones
- Analysing Software Repositories to Understand Software Evolution
- Predicting Bugs from History
- Reengineering of Legacy Systems
- Object-Oriented Reengineering
- Migration of Legacy Information Systems
- Architectural Transformations: From Legacy to Three-Tier and Services
- Novel Trends in Software Evolution
- On the Interplay Between Software Testing and Evolution and its Effect on Program Comprehension
- Evolution Issues in Aspect-Oriented Programming
- Software Architecture Evolution
- Empirical Studies of Open Source Evolution.